What this often looks like
- Overthinking conversations long after they have ended
- Preparing for every possible outcome, just in case
- Replaying things you said and wishing you had said them differently
- A body that feels braced for something to go wrong
- Looking completely fine from the outside while it quietly exhausts you
- Turning down things you actually want, in case they go badly

How we approach it
My approach is warm, collaborative, and rooted in acceptance. Rather than treating anxiety as something you need to fight or "fix" overnight, we make space to understand what your anxiety is trying to protect you from, how it shows up in your daily life, and what patterns might be keeping you stuck.
In therapy, we may explore anxious thoughts, physical symptoms, avoidance, perfectionism, people-pleasing, self-criticism, and the pressure to always have things figured out. I draw from CBT, DBT, ACT, and mindfulness-based therapy, tailoring our work to you rather than using a one-size-fits-all approach. Together, we can build practical tools for managing anxiety while also helping you relate to yourself with more compassion.
Anxiety therapy is not about becoming a perfectly calm person who never worries. It is about creating enough space between you and your anxiety that you can make choices based on what matters to you, not only what feels safest in the moment.
